Comprehending Thai Massage: An Ancient Therapeutic Art

Thai massage, a time-honored practice rooted in ancient healing traditions, offers a unique blend of physical and spiritual rejuvenation. This therapeutic art form integrates elements of yoga, acupressure, and meditative practices, creating a holistic experience that transcends mere physical relaxation. Practitioners utilize a series of coordinated movements, careful stretching, and pressure administered along energy lines, known as "Sen," to release tension and promote balance within the body. Unlike conventional massages, Thai massage is performed on a mat, allowing for greater freedom of movement and flexibility. The practitioner's body weight is often used to enhance the effectiveness of the techniques, providing deep muscle relaxation without the use of oils. In addition, the spiritual aspect encourages mindfulness and self-awareness, fostering a deeper connection between body and mind. This ancient practice not only addresses physical discomfort but also contributes to overall well-being, making it a valued selection for those seeking extensive health benefits.

What Clothing Should I Wear During a Thai Massage?

Loose-fitting, comfortable attire is suggested for a Thai massage session. Clothing like yoga pants or soft shorts provides ease of movement, guaranteeing the recipient can fully enjoy the massage techniques employed.

How Long Does a Typical Thai Massage Last?

A typical Thai massage session lasts between 60 to 120 minutes. The duration might differ depending on individual preferences and the specific techniques employed by the therapist, providing a personalized experience for each client.

Are There Contraindications Associated with Thai Massage?

Certain health conditions could contraindicate Thai massage, including fractures, severe osteoporosis, skin infections, or recent surgeries. Expectant mothers and those with cardiovascular conditions should consult a healthcare professional before receiving this type of therapy.

Can Pregnant Women Receive Massage Therapy?

Yes, expectant mothers can get massages, but it is important to speak with a healthcare provider initially. Particular methods and positions need to be adapted to provide safety and comfort for the mother and baby.
